Snow report Forno hut SAC, 04/09/2019
Monte del Forno
Snow condition
Snow quality
Overall impression
Snow condition
There is an extraordinary amount of snow in the entire Forno area. Both the approach through Val Forno and the glaciers are very well snowed in. There is about 3 meters of snow at the Forno hut.
Snow quality
Thanks to this morning's snowfall, powder snow everywhere, although the snow slowly became heavy below approx. 2800m in the afternoon (on all exposures). Nevertheless, the descent from the summit to the hut was still great.
Risks
It had snowed around 30 cm in the morning. There was no wind, but due to the warm temperatures, the snow in the lower part of the tour was already starting to get wet. At the same time, there was a crust of melted snow on the old snow cover up to an altitude of around 2750m, so there was a risk of wet slides on this sliding surface. Here it was particularly important to avoid steep slopes (spontaneous slides also came from the steep slopes). The situation was rather better in the upper part of the tour. Overall, however, the avalanche situation was not to be underestimated today. The fresh snow that fell settled very quickly.
Overall impression
You just had to be quite defensive on the road. Nevertheless, the tour was absolutely worthwhile.
